Job summary

Hereford Road Surgery

To provide and maintain a high standard of nursing care for patients, as well as providing nursing assistance to the doctors and other members of the primary healthcare team. The duties will include all tasks normally undertaken by an experienced RGN and any additional roles agreed between the nurse and the doctors as appropriate, having regard to current training.

The successful candidate will be employed by the GP Practice/Medical Centre, not Aneurin Bevan University Health Board

About Hereford Road Surgery

This Surgery came into being in July 1999 out of a need to create more and better opportunities for primary medical services in North Monmouthshire.The Surgery is situated conveniently near the centre of Abergavenny, adjacent to the market. There is adequate parking for twenty five cars around the building including some space for the disabled.There are currently four GP Partners, Dr Huw Williams, Dr Louise Hull, Dr Paul Maslin, and Dr Maria Stone, they are supported by Dr Ruksha Bhadresha.We offer a full general practice service and run specialist clinics for children and pregnant women, diabetes and asthma sufferers and for patients needing minor surgery. We also offer an on-site dispensing service.At Hereford Road Surgery we aim to treat all our patients promptly, courteously and in complete confidence. The Surgery is staffed by a full complement of nurses, receptionists, dispensary and administrative personnel whose aim is to provide the best possible service in a friendly and efficient manner.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.

Certificate of Sponsorship

Applications from job seekers who require current Skilled worker sponsorship to work in the UK are welcome and will be considered alongside all other applications. For further information visit the UK Visas and Immigration website (Opens in a new tab).

From 6 April 2017, skilled worker applicants, applying for entry clearance into the UK, have had to present a criminal record certificate from each country they have resided continuously or cumulatively for 12 months or more in the past 10 years. Adult dependants (over 18 years old) are also subject to this requirement. Guidance can be found here Criminal records checks for overseas applicants (Opens in a new tab).
